Question #191420
  1. How efficient is a machine that takes in 24000J of energy and produces 8000J of useful energy?


  1. A machine which is 70% efficient has a power input of 360W.  What is the power output?


  1. A motor which is 60% efficient has an output power of 480 W. What is its input power?


  1. An electric motor rated at 500 W runs for 2 minutes and does 45 kJ of work.


a)     What is its input energy?

b)     What is its efficiency?


  1. What is the efficiency of a motor rated at 750 W which can lift a 25 kg load to a height of 4 m in 2 s?
1
Expert's answer
2021-05-12T08:38:24-0400

1.

"\\eta=\\frac{Q_o}{Q_i}=0.33=33\\%."

2.

"P_o=\\eta P_i=252~W."

3.

"P_i=\\frac{P_o}{\\eta}=800~W."

4a.

"A_i=Pt=60~kJ."

4b.

"\\eta=\\frac{A_o}{Pt}=0.75=75\\%."

5.

"\\eta=\\frac{A}{Pt}=\\frac{mgh}{Pt}=0.67=67\\%."
